About Vanrhyns Pass
Originally built and designed by Thomas Bain, the Vanrhyns Pass forms part of the R27 between Vanrhynsdorp and Nieuwoudtville. This 9km pass ascends 595 metres to the summit. The Bokkeveld Plateau is at the top of the pass. Over 800 metres above sea level, the lookout point provides spectacular views of the Knersvlakte, the Hardeveld and the Maskam region.
